## Spectral Seriation
## Ding, C. and Xiaofeng He (2004): Linearized cluster assignment via
## spectral orderingProceedings of the Twenty-first.
## International Conference on Machine learning (ICML '04)
## Minimizes: sum_{i,j} (i-j)^2 * d_{pi_i,pi_j}
seriate_dist_spectral <- function(x, control = NULL) {
#param <- .get_parameters(control, NULL)
.get_parameters(control, NULL)
### calculate Laplacian
W <- 1 / (1 + as.matrix(x))
D <- diag(rowSums(W))
L <- D - W
## The Fiedler vector is the eigenvector with the smallest eigenvalue
## eigen reports eigenvectors/values in decreasing order
q <- eigen(L)
fiedler <- q$vectors[, ncol(W) - 1L]
o <- order(fiedler)
names(fiedler) <- attr(x, "Labels")
attr(o, "configuration") <- fiedler
o
}
